Bears fans will once again be able to follow every exciting play of Baylor Athletics this season on the Baylor Sports Media Network thanks to its experienced crew of professionals who broadcast the action worldwide.
Recognized by the National Sports Media Association as the 2019 Texas Co-Sportscaster of the Year and newly named to the 2026 Baylor Athletics Hall of Fame class, The “Voice of the Bears,” John Morris (Baylor, 1980), enters his 32nd season as the signature voice of Baylor Athletics. This is his 40th season overall including his eight years working with the legendary Frank Fallon. He has also been behind the mic for Baylor Basketball, Women’s Basketball, Baseball, Softball, Volleyball, Soccer, Track & Field, Equestrian, Men’s & Women’s Tennis and Acrobatics & Tumbling.
Football alum Geff Gandy will serve as the football in-booth color commentator, alongside Morris, while alum Bryson Jackson will roam the sidelines as the analyst. Gandy replaces former BU quarterback Nick Florence, who served in the role in 2025, and Jackson will take over the sideline commentating duties from Ricky Thompson, who spent 26 years fulfilling the duties. The triumvirate boasts six decades of Baylor football coverage and experience.
The team is supported by Bob Baker, the football broadcast engineer who is in his 14th season, and Jeff Walter, who provides statistical and spotting input for the sixth season.
